Purpose & Scope

The Supervisor Manufacturing will be a key contributor to manufacturing readiness and future operational output. The role will initially support commissioning and start-up activities as the GMP facility is built. This includes equipment testing, layout planning, SOP and other documentation generation, as well as the recruitment and training of staff. After the startup of manufacturing operations are complete, the role will be responsible for executing a combination of engineering, clinical, and process qualification (PPQ) batches with supporting staff. This role, as part of the Manufacturing leadership team, will be an integral contributor tasked with building a diverse and technically strong team for future successful GMP operations.

Role and Responsibilities

  • Ensure seamless transfer of information and responsibilities across shifts and between processing areas

  • Hire, train, supervise, and develop subordinate Manufacturing Associates while ensuring all parties are compliant with required GMP training and related documentation

  • Support drafting and/or approval of manufacturing documentation, including SOPs and batch records

  • Coordinate with other departments to schedule work and other activities that impact manufacturing site milestones and/or process schedules

  • Coordinate with Supply Chain and the Warehouse to ensure materials and other consumables are ordered and received in time for both commissioning and production needs

  • Support and/or own quality investigations, CAPAs, and other compliance issues, ensuring that process improvement ideas and/or CAPA’s are implemented in a timely manner.

  • Support regulatory inspection activities for manufacturing areas, personnel, and procedures

  • Attend safety meetings, ensure that staff adheres to all safety procedures as defined, and maintain a safe work environment within manufacturing owned areas

  • Review all executed batch records and other documentation generated from the Manufacturing floor and ensure compliance with all approved procedures and cGMP requirements

  • Build effective working relationships with cross-functional disciplines, ensuring company goals, process investigations, and improvement initiatives are carried out in an effective and collaborative manner

Required Qualifications

  • BS / BA in Chemical/ Biological Engineering or Life Sciences with 4+ years of applicable industry experience or Associate’s degree in science with 6+ years of industry experience or H.S. diploma with 8+ years of industry experience

  • 1-2 years of experience leading teams, including peers, in a GMP manufacturing environment

  • Technical understanding of a biotech manufacturing facility, with detailed knowledge of fill finish (drug product) operations and working with sterile injectables.

  • Proven effective problem-solving skills with an ability react quickly to process challenges

  • Strong safety focus with a proven ability to promote safety awareness within manufacturing organization

  • Will support and demonstrate quality standards to ensure data of highest quality.

  • Outstanding communicator with ability to work independently when required as well as closely within a team that may include external disciplines and key stakeholders.

  • Will be expected to perform other duties and/or special projects, as assigned.

  • Strong understanding of sterile drug product manufacturing processes and controls, including formulation, sterile filtration, aseptic filling, container closure systems, cleanroom behavior, environmental monitoring, and contamination control.
